Enactment

Enactment noun - A rule of conduct or action laid down by a governing authority and especially a legislature.

Measure is a synonym for enactment in decree topic. In some cases you can use "Measure" instead a noun "Enactment", when it comes to topics like law, bill.

Measure

Measure noun - An action planned or taken to achieve a desired result.

Enactment is a synonym for measure in law topic. Sometimes you can use "Enactment" instead a noun "Measure", if it concerns topics such as bill.
